I have been working on making a little applet that can let me more easily split a Harbor file into yearly layers, such as what we did in FotRSU. The main issue in Harbors in OM (as in Stock SH4 & SH3) is the fact that one file runs the duration, and a ship might be set to attempt its spawn percentage every 1200-2400 hours, which is "only" every 50-100 days. If a ship is set to a 40% chance of spawning (rough average), then there will be a new ship spawned approximately every 70 to 140 days, which might come out to 5 to 10 ships each year... If you are going into a harbor that started on 1939-01-01, and it is now 1945-05-01, with the ship set to the duration, you might see dozens of ships spawned into each other. As the wind blows, a ship will 'move', and you can 'see' the next one spawned inside the first. Sometimes, the "collision avoidance" kicks in, and you will see explosions, smoke and fire as the ships destroy each other, like there was a harbor raider, but its only the unlimited spawning... forgot to say a tip:

- Once you have made identification with your weapon officer (ID order bar button) call up your ID book to show and click on the ship name at bottom of periscope view ——> it will open automatically the ID book at the right page (avoiding tons of clicking to find it)

- If you plan to use the AOBF wheel with your 1920X1080 install, don’t forget to get the AOBF for 16/9 mod in main OMEGU mod!

- Calculating distance is much more accurate using zoom X6 and the top black line of AOBF, rather than zoom X1,5 and bottom right black line ...

- For target speed, U-Jagd chrono seems more accurate than AOBF wheel.

propbeanie 11-14-19 06:57 PM

No, no saving that... re-do your SH4 install and run JSGME so that it creates a MODS folder, then put the OM zip files in that MODS folder. Use 7zip or your favorite archive program to extract the OM mod. The OM 705 mod is straight-forward, so just directly activate with JSGME after unzipping the archive file. The update to OM 720 is similar, in that after extracting, just activate the mod with JSGME. The 720Patch5 is similarly constructed, so just activate with JSGME after extracting it in the MODS folder. When you do OMEGU, it is done similarly to the "regular" mods. The OMEGU Patch 7 is different. It has mods inside the "package" folder that you'll have to copy and / or drag out to the JSGME MODS folder in your game's folder, and then activated with JSGME. For Fifi's work, the folders are constructed correctly. You extract his 7zip file inside of the game's MODS folder, and then just activate that. The "MODS" folder inside of the mod package will end up putting optional mods inside the MODS folder. In all cases, use JSGME to activate the MODS. Anymore issues, just post back. :salute:

Fifi 11-18-19 02:32 AM

Quote:

Originally Posted by subdizzle (Post 2636943)
Ok, there are download links in the original post for both update 2 and update 11. Do i install them both?

Install after the 3 OM mods and the 2 OMEGU mods my Fifi Compilation for OM+OMEGU and then the last Update 11 :yep:

Like this:

OpsMonsun_V705
OMv705_to_V720
OMv720_Patch5
OMEGU_v300
OMEGU_v300_Patch7
KiUB_English (can be find inside OMEGU_v300)
Magnified Hud Dials for OM+OMEGU_Medium
Fifi Compilation for OM+OMEGU
Fifi Compilation_Update_11

Or wait for next version still in tests, it will have only 1 mod to activate!
No more OM, no more OMEGU, all will be compiled.
